The JBL VRX918SP is a powered, suspendable subwoofer system containing a 2268FF neodymium magnet, patented Differential Drive, 18" woofer in a front-loaded, vented enclosure. The VRX918SP was designed specifically for use in arrays with the VRX932LAP Line Array speaker and VRX-AF Array Frame. In addition it may also be used in arrays consisting entirely of VRX918SP subwoofers.
Equally at home in ground stacked applications, the VRX918SP is equipped with a top-mounted, threaded, 20 mm socket that can receive the optional SS4-BK pole. This adjustable height pole can be used to mount speakers equipped with standard 36 mm pole sockets and weighing up to 100 lb. The threaded socket minimizes buzzing and rattling and assures that the pole will be secure and straight.
The enclosure is constructed of top quality birch plywood, coated in JBL’s rugged DuraFlex finish and is heavily braced to maximize low-frequency performance. The attractive CNC- machined, 16-gauge steel grille is internally lined with acoustically transparent foam to provide additional driver protection and give a very professional appearance. The rear of the enclosure is fitted with T-nuts which may be used to attach the optional WK-4S caster kit.
Features
• Built-in Drivepack DPC-2 amplifier module with 1500 Watts of peak power
• DSP provides system optimization, EQ and crossover functionality
• 18-inch, 2268FF dual voice coil, neodymium magnet Differential Drive woofer
• Integral rigging hardware for simple connection of enclosures
• 20 mm threaded pole socket for solid, secure satellite speaker mounting
• Large port area for reduced distortion
